Svartensgatan 7 Interior design and graphic profile for Svartensgatan 7. The design is futuristic with a color palette in subtle, natural colors juxtaposed with harsh fluorescent lighting. Glass surfaces, light panels and walls are covered by illustrations and typography that capture fictional environments and people in motion. The custom components, such as shelving and the reception desk, are made out of lacquered naked MDF. Oblique angles, inspired by the number seven, appear repeatedly throughout the space, for instance, the sloping sides of the reception desk. The lighting is clustered in the center of the ceiling, with tangled cords and a sense of randomness. The new interior includes a retail area, a reception, seventeen work stations, two shampoo stations and a lounge, which all together take up a total area of 260 sq meters. |

Optilon Graphic & Interior Design. Supply Chain Management agency, Optilon in Stockholm. The concept is inspired from the fashion industry and specifically, the style of Japanese designer Yohji Yamamoto. Futuristic cuttings play the masculine against the feminine. Yamamoto’s asymmetric and poetic draped dresses informed our use of a black and white base with an unusual punctuation of bright colours. The chosen palette and form also resemble the landscape of an archipelago. |

Suite 809 Graphic Design. Design for one off Suite at the Hotel Anglais. The view from the room made us start thinking of throwing paperplanes towards the park. That’s how we came up with the idea for this artwork. The illustrations simply symbolize the start process of folding paper planes. The most basic paper plane would only take at most six steps to complete. Leonardo da Vinci is often cited as the inventor of paper planes, although this is debatable since the Chinese invented both modern paper and the kite. The earliest known date of the creation of modern paper planes was said to have been in 1909. |

”Joe Cool” Exhibition Artwork for “Joe Cool” exhibition & auction. Snoopy in a black box in shape of a dog-house. Height 45, width 29, depth 22 cm. Auction held by Bukowskis. In celebration of Snoopy's 60th anniversary, a number of Swedish creators have been invited to design their own personal interpretation of Joe Cool. These styled statuettes show the many faces of Cool. Proceeds go directly to Friends, a non-profit charitable organization which educates schools and athletic organizations to prevent and stop bullying. 2010. |
